LIFE IS MY SONG: The Autobiography of John Gould Fletcher New York: Farrar Rinehart, (1937). New York: Farrar Rinehart, Incorporated, (1937). First edition, first printing. Publisher's seal insignia, indicating a first printing, to the copyright page. Former owner's name to the front end-paper, end-papers age-toned as usual, tear to the crown of the spine, cover borders lightly age-toned, else very good in pale green/grey cloth with black embossed titles to the front cover and to the spine; lacking a dust jacket. A somewhat elusive autobiography. The Pulitzer Prize winning poet's philosophically reflective life and career story, spiced with poems, and with accounts of friendships and meetings with other authors, especially with Ezra Pound and Amy Lowell.
